Winter Safety Focus of Alzheimer's Association Northwest Ohio Chapter Advice for Alzheimer’s Caregivers

“Families and individuals of loved ones living with Alzheimer’s should take advantage of the extensive suggestions and planning resources provided on the Alzheimer’s Association Northwest Ohio Chapter website at alz.org/nwohio,” said Pamela Myers, Alzheimer's Association Northwest Ohio Chapter program director. “There are valuable resources in the help and support sections on our website concerning safety, wandering behaviors, dementia and driving, and preparing for emergencies. Caregivers can also call us directly at 419.537.1999 for specific answers or assistance.”
